Real Estate in Portugal Bought Directly with Bitcoin for the First Time

For the first time, real estate in Portugal was purchased without conversion to fiat money, directly paid in Bitcoin.

According to a report by the local newspaper Idealista, it was a first in the country. Although it requires some additional steps, this is the first time a real estate has been purchased in the country by paying Bitcoin directly. The property was purchased for 3 BTC, which corresponds to roughly 102,000 euros ($108,000).

Buying real estate with crypto assets required buyers to convert their holdings into euros first until last month. Also, the country’s notary law has set clear rules on how to create title deeds for real estate sales made directly in crypto. Real estate company Zome said in a statement on the subject:

“This deed represents a historic milestone, the transfer of a digital asset to a physical asset – a house without conversion into euros.”

In the process of creating the deed, there is some information in addition to the ordinary details such as the relevant Bitcoin address and proof that the crypto transaction took place.
